What does being a Senior Game Designer at Ludia look like :
As a Senior Game Designer, you will report to the Lead designer and you will work directly with the team members, designers, artists, data scientists and developers on an unannounced game. You’ll work on an unannounced game, based on one of the most famous licenses in the world.

Ludia is a prominent mobile video game studio based in Canada, known for crafting innovative and engaging games like Jurassic World™ and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les. We build experiences that resonate with players, combining quality gameplay with a deep commitment to community and connection.
